Output dd50fe68efb52b62056e835a6e2218e28dd05702d0a4d3f415fb2dd82d609846:0

value
61045638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509ce98c2d889913369a6b7277fa64e9ed7ce196 OP_EQUALVERIFY OP_CHECKSIG
address
18MF2od7AgMD4iHH4vZ6XWoTz2QT1TP9Qs
transaction
dd50fe68efb52b62056e835a6e2218e28dd05702d0a4d3f415fb2dd82d609846
spent
true